Carbon monoxide alarm activation in Watertown apartment, Watertown WI
Heads up: This post was detected from real-time dispatch audio. Information may be incomplete, and the situation may evolve. Always verify using official agency releases.
A carbon monoxide detector activated in an apartment near North 2nd Street and Lynn Street in Watertown. The caller evacuated the building but no one reported feeling ill.
